A box contains five red marbles, seven white marbles, and four green marbles. A student is computing probabilities by drawing ma

rbles out of the box. Drawing one marble, what is the probability that it is red?

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

you have a total of 5+7+4=16 marbles in the box.

5 are red

7 are white

4 are green

If you randomly select 1 marble out of the box, the probabilities are:

5/16 chance of being red

7/16 chance of being white

4/16 chance of being green

Find three consecutive natural numbers if the square of the smallest number is 65 less than the product of the remaining two num
Vedmedyk [2.9K]

Answer:

21, 22, and 23

Step-by-step explanation:

Three consecutive natural numbers can be represented as n, n+1, and n+2.

The square of the smallest number would be n^2 and its equal to the product of the other two (n+1)(n+2).

So the equation is n^2 = (n+1)(n+2) -65\\n^2 = n^2 +n+2n+2-65\\n^2=n^2+3n-63\\0=3n-63\\63=3n\\ 21=n.

If n is 21 then the next numbers are 22 and 23.
